Product Definition:
A memristor is a passive electronic component that remembers the amount of current that has flowed through it in the past and can release this memory to control the current flow in future. Memristors are important because they could potentially be used to create more efficient and faster computer processors, as well as devices with novel capabilities such as brain-computer interfaces.
